If you have Element Desktop installed, and choose Element as your preferred client, then matrix.to links open in a page like this:

If you then click "Continue", then the link opens in Element Desktop. Great success! Meanwhile the matrix.to tab updates to:

This is maybe a bit confusing, but ok. Normally I just ignore it.
The question is: what happens if you click "Continue in your browser". My expectation is that it opens that one link in https://app.element.io, and that future matrix.to links will go back to opening in Element Desktop.
However, what actually happens is that the next time you open a matrix.to link, it will default to Element Web. Worse, it's unclear how to repair the damage. (Turns out, you can click "Change", then "Element" again, and that fixes it.)
TL;DR
STR:
- Click "Continue in your browser"
- Open another matrix.to link
- Be surprised that it now defaults to opening in Element Web.
